Composition:
GEMCITABINE-1GM
Uses:
Breast Cancer, Pancreatic Cancer, Non-small-cell Lung Cancer, Bladder Cancer, and Ovarian Cancer.
Medicinal Benefits:
C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M is an anti-cancer drug used in the treatment of various types of cancers. C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M is used either independently or in conjunction with other chemotherapy medications to treat breast cancer, pancreatic cancer, non-small cell lung cancer, bladder cancer, and ovarian cancer. C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M works by interfering with DNA synthesis. It blocks the production of new DNA, by locking itself into the DNA strands and inhibiting any further proliferation or growth of the cell. Hence, C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M has widespread application in the field of oncology (cancer-related medicine) and chemotherapy.
C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M works blocking DNA synthesis and causing cell death, thereby preventing the cells from proliferating beyond normal.
Men taking C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M are advised not to father a child during the treatment with C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M and for 6months after the treatment. Consult your doctor before starting C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M if you are planning to father a child. Your doctor may advise you regarding sperm storage.
If you suffer from CKD, please consult with your doctor before using C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M and discuss any concerns with them. C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M is to be used with caution in those suffering from kidney and liver problems.
C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M might cause low white blood cell count leading to increased risk of infections. Consult your doctor if you have a fever, sweating, and any signs of infections.
CYTOGEM INJECTION 1GM may cause bleeding and bruising due to less platelet count. Consult a doctor if you notice unexpected bruising, pinkish or reddish urine, bleeding from gums, mouth, or nose.
